Overview Manali is one of the most picturesque locations in India. Known as a hill station and tourist destination, Manali is set amid the beautiful peaks of the Himalayas. A visit to this place can be an amazing experience if you’re looking for something not …
Places To Visit In Manali For The Adventurous Traveller!
